The Spotlight on Best Western Chiswick Palace & Suites London

Charming Comfort in West London, Close to the Action

Modern convenience meets classic charm at the Best Western Chiswick Palace & Suites London. Set inside an elegant period property on Chiswick High Road, this hotel blends traditional London architecture with updated interiors. Located just a 5-minute walk from Turnham Green Underground Station, you're well connected to the heart of the city while enjoying a quieter, village-like vibe in Chiswick.
Rooms are clean, colorful, and come with free Wi-Fi, private modern bathrooms, and all the essentials like tea/coffee and hairdryers. It's a smart base for concert-goers wanting comfort without the chaos of central London.

Why Concert-goers love it

Thanks to its proximity to the Tube, you're just a 20-minute ride to central London—perfect for getting to major venues without staying in the middle of the late-night buzz. After the show, return to a peaceful neighborhood that’s far calmer than the city centre. The 14:00 check-in and 11:00 check-out are great for those catching late gigs or early flights. Plus, being close to the A4 and M4 makes it super convenient for those driving in.

Food and Drink Options

While there’s no on-site restaurant for dinner, the hotel offers a daily breakfast—ideal after a late night out. Chiswick High Road is lined with independent cafes, pubs, and global eateries just steps away, so you won’t go hungry. While there’s no 24/7 room service, the area is known for its late-night takeaways and convenience stores.

Nightlife Options

Though the hotel itself is more about quiet comfort than loud music, it’s just a few Tube stops from lively areas like Hammersmith and Shepherd’s Bush, where you’ll find bars, clubs, and live music venues. For those wanting to stay local, Chiswick’s pubs and wine bars offer a more relaxed vibe with craft beers and cocktails.

Areas for Improvement

Rooms can be a bit compact, especially if you're sharing with mates and carrying gear. Some guests noted thin walls, so light sleepers may want to pack earplugs. There's also no lift in parts of the hotel, which could be tricky with heavy bags.
